## Sample Shipments — Verrow Analytics Lab

All tissue and soil samples bound for Verrow Analytics go out Tuesdays via the Kestrel Courier run. Records team logs each crate in the transit ledger before sealing. Use the blue tamper tags only; green tags are for internal moves. Verrow will not accept unlogged crates — no exceptions. Chain-of-custody sheet travels inside the lid pouch, copy stays with us. The courier hand-over instruction below is confidential.

courier memo of kahap-faweg: the kasok eliiel courier leaves the noveth gilael weniel ledger at gate 9433 under passcode 012665

## Glimmerpane Environments

Staging and prod run the same image-cache build since v4.2. Known issue: the thumbnail cache leaks roughly 40 MB/hour under sustained uploads because evicted entries keep decoder handles alive. Fix landed in v4.3 but is only deployed to staging. Until prod is upgraded, the cache pods restart nightly via a cron in the ops namespace. Do not raise the memory limit to mask this. The current prod settings are listed below.

service settings:
[silwyn]
host = silwyn.crelvogrid.internal
user = silwyn_svc
database = silwyn_prod

Facilities Ticket — First-Aid Room, Varrow House

Hi new folks! Quick heads-up: the first-aid room on Level 2 (next to the Brindle kitchenette) is getting restocked this week, so the supplies cupboard may look a bit bare. Bandages and ice packs are still in the wall unit. The room stays locked outside office hours, so you'll need the code below to get in.

turnstile pass: bdg-KUDKL-55212

## Data Stores: FX Rounding Ledger

The Coinrow conversion service stores amounts as integer minor units; rounding deltas from currency conversion are accumulated in the `fx_remainder` table and reconciled nightly. Access is read-only except for the reconciler role. To audit reconciliation entries, connect to the ledger replica using the string below.

primary connection of yagep-kahip = redis://giliel_svc:zYiKsLL2PLpfPL@db-348f.xolmarsys.corp:5432/fenwyn